1. Recover unsaved Illustrator files
There are two methods to recover unsaved Illustrator files after a crash.
a) Automatic recovery
In the Illustrator software there is an automatic recovery feature that allows you recover unsaved file instantly after an accident. Just restart the software as soon as it crashes and you will see the recently unsaved file open on the screen with the file name prefixed with Recovered.
Once the file is recovered, you can save it by clicking File > Save As. It was easy, right?

b) Recovery from backup file
Suppose after the software crashes, you relaunch it and find no unsaved recovered files in it. Don’t worry in this case you can make use of the backup files.
However, for this method to work, the backup option must be enabled in the software. If it is not enabled by default, you can enable it by following these steps.
- 1. Open the software Adobe Illustrator CC and go to Edit in the upper left corner of the board.
- 2. From here select the option Preferences > General…
- 3. Now, under General Settings, click File and clipboard management. Here check the box that says Automatically save recovery data every: and then select the time period, that is, how often you want the software to save your file in the backup.
The software gives you the opportunity to select time periods ranging from 30 seconds to 1 hour. It is recommended that you select less time to save files, 30 seconds or 1 minute is a good option.

Once backup is enabled, the software starts saving the backup of your Adobe Illustrator files. These files are saved in the local to your computer and here is how you can find them in case you want to recover unsaved Illustrator files from backup.
Find unsaved files in the backup folder
- 1. Press Windows+R to open Execute. Now write %appdata% in the text box and press the button okay.
- 2. A new window will open and select the folder named Adobe.
- 3. Next, in Adobe go to Adobe Illustrator 23 Settings > en_us > x64. Now select the folder DataRecovery.
- 4. In DataRecovery, you will find the unsaved Illustrator file. Now click on the file and open it with Illustrator.
Once the file is open in Illustrator, you can save the file by giving it an appropriate name. This is how to recover unsaved Illustrator files after a crash. Now let’s see how you can recover deleted files from Illustrator.

2. Restore a deleted Adobe Illustrator file
If you have saved the Illustrator file on your device and it has been accidentally deleted or deleted due to a virus attack, then you can recover it by following these steps.
a) Recover the temporarily deleted file
If you recently deleted the file without clicking Shift+Deletethen it should be in the Recycle Bin or Trash (in the case of ). Restoring deleted files from here is very easy.
Open the Recycle Bin and find the lost Illustrator file. Once you find the file, right-click on it and click Restore and the file will be restored to your computer.
The same process can be followed on Mac and restore an Illustrator file deleted from Trash as well.
b) Recover a permanently deleted Illustrator file
Sometimes you can permanently delete files by emptying the Recycle Bin or a virus attack can delete the file permanently. In such a case, you cannot restore the file from the Recycle Bin.

3. Recover saved Illustrator files
Let’s say you’ve edited your Illustrator project and saved those changes but now you want to go back to the previous version of the file and all the changes. It’s easy to do this if you’re still editing the file in Illustrator, as you have the option to revert to the original version of the file in the software itself.
But, What if you want to undo changes to a Saved Over file? Don’t worry, there is still some hope that you can return to an unedited version of your file. However, for this to happen, system backup must be enabled on your device.
If system backup is enabled, it is very easy to revert to the previous version of any file. You just have to select the saved file and right click on it. By doing so new options will appear, here select the option Restore previous versions.
This will open a new window showing all previous saved versions of the file. From here, you can select the version of the file you want to revert to. Similarly, you can restore the old version of a file. Illustrator using the Time Machine feature on Mac.
